Health Officials Say there are now, 36 confirmed cases of the the zika virus right here in the u. S. And that includes four pregnant woman. In brazil where the virus may have originated governmental troops are going door to door to track mosquitoes believed to be spreading the virus. Currently there is no vaccine, so eliminating mosquito breeding areas has become the first line of defense. More than 4,000 cases of the virus, have been diagnosed, in brazil. Well, time is running out to sign up for Health Insurance this year under the the Affordable Care act. Tomorrow is the last chance to sign up for coverage, that will take effect in march. If you are eligible and you do not sign up, you may be subject to a 700dollar fine on your next years tax bill. The government hopes to sign up about 10 million people. It seems a selfie crazies now complete thely out of this world. Nasas Curiosity Mars rover snapped this selfie on the red planet the showing off terrain where it has been working for past five months. Selfie is a combination of 57 images taking from the rovers robotic arm. The self portrait shows curiosity at a socalled dune, where it has been digging in the dune collecting samples for lab analysis. Nasa says were learning more about where the moon came from. Evidence comes from rocks brought back by the the apollo astronauts more than 40 years ago. Scientists had a theory that the moon formed after a small planet collided with the earth. They now say crash was a head on collision four and a half billion years ago not a glancing blow as thought. The impact release aid chunk of earth that became a one and only moon. Evident is identical chemical signature, between the the moon roxanne volcanic rocks found in hawaii and arizona. Im glad we werent here for that.
